Sewer line blockages could lead to raw sewage backing up and finding its way into your shower or sink drains. Sewer line backups usually result in an expensive repair job. The cost of having to replace vanities, floors, and even support joists because of a backed-up sewer main can exceed the cost of the plumbing repair quickly, making early detection and repair crucial to keeping costs down.
There are many reasons why the sewer line could become blocked. A high amount of paper usage, oil and grease from kitchen waste hair, and soapy residue from sinks and showers could all result in troubling sewer line blockages.
If a homeowner is willing to risk getting a little messy cleaning the main sewer line could be a do-it-yourself project. Start by turning the main water line to the home off. Find a small, round PVC pipe that has a rubber or plastic screw-on cap at the end. The removal of the cap will relieve the pressure that has built up and cause water to flow out from (rather rather than back into) the home.

A variety of things could cause a sewer to cease to flow, for example, impacted soil or freezing ground. Also, the buildup of paper, grease, and other wastes that are foreign to the system can block proper flow through the pipe. Another reason for this is root infiltration, where roots from a nearby tree or tree get into the sewer line through an opening and then expand to fill the pipe with a hairy root mass. If not addressed right away blocked pipes can cause the pipe to explode, break, or collapse. Such damage will require the repair or replacement of the sewer line.
